Your First Day!

Every Player will start their game falling from the sky with a Parachute attached, this is so you do not get spawn killed on your first day choose a good spot to land and get going.

As well as a Parachute you will be given a Starter Kit, place it down and open it to obtain a few items to get you started.

Getting Food!

Animals will not give you food just because you killed them, you will need to use a Sharp Tool to get the meat from the Animals manually, if the aniamls has not been vaccinated then you will only get Contaminated Meat from them. Contaminated Meat has a high chance of giving you the Hunger effect.

Your main source of food will come from looting Food Boxes and Food Cupboards in Structures

Rats and Crows can be killed for thier meat, cook it first though.

Get Tooled Up!

By looting Structures you will come across some basic tools to help you kill the Zombies, things like Screwdrivers, Hammers and Baseball Bats.

If you are unable to find a Tool try mining some stone to turn into Small Rocks to throw at the Zombies.

Trade Items!

As you loot more and more Structures you will notice items like Shampoo and Toilet Roll, they may seem like completely pointless items but they are probably the most imortant as they are the items used to trade with other Humans, collect all these items as they will be useful in the future.

Humanity!

On your travels you will notice more secure less run down Structures, these are other Humans who are surviving the Apocalypse. These Humans will have some items to trade you,

If your stuck on what to do next try speaking to the Survivors, they will have hints and tips to give you clues on where to go. Sneak and Interact to talk to the Survivors.

Shoot em’ all!

Guns are a big part of staying alive in a Zombie Apocalypse. Hand Guns can be found in Military Crates in Structures, more powerful guns will need to be traded or found in a Supply Crate.

Guns will only shoot if the player has the correct ammunition in their inventory. Each Gun requires it’s own ammunition which can be found or crafted.

Gunpowder!

Finding ammunition can get a little tedious, as finding more and more Structures can get harder.

Creating your own ammunition is the best way of making sure you never run out.

Anything to do with ammunition creation will be done on an Ammunition Bench.

You will need a few materials to create your own ammunition.

You will have to go mining for all the ingredients for ammunition creation, Sulfur and Potassium Nitrate ore both generate in warm Biomes like the Desert, Savanna and Mesa at around 30 on the “Y” axis.

You will also need Melted Copper for the Bullet casing.

Craft the Potassium Nitrate, Sulfur and a little Charcoal together to create Gunpowder.

Other Weapons!

Sentry Guns and Deadwave Emitters are a great way to keep your base safe without shooting through endless bullets.

You can find the pieces of the Sentry Gun in Military Crate in Structures, Craft them together to create a Sentry Gun.

Place a Sentry Gun down and load it with Sentry Gun Ammunition, the Sentry Gun will become active and shoot any Zombie it sees, keep an eye on the ammo inside the Gun as they will run out.

Deadwave Emitters can be found in Military Crates in Structures, place it down and power it with a Battery and it will send out a sound that will despawn any Zombie with it sound radius.

Interact with the Deadwave Emitter with a Breaking Tool to pick it up and move it.

Grenades are also a massive help . There are four types of Grenade you can find when looting.

Grenade – Works like a normal Greande.

Flash Greande – Will slow down any entity within its radius.

Smoke Grenade – Will distract the Zombies away from you.

Toxic Gas Grenade – Will slowly poison any entity within it’s radius

Body Armor!

Body Armor can be found in Military Crates in Structures or Traded!

Head Gear!

Head Gear can be found in Military Crates in Structures or Traded!

Gas Mask is required to be able to breathe in the Nether.

Night Vision Goggles will allow you to see in the dark.

Scuba Goggles will allow you to breathe underwater.

Razor Wire!

You can craft Razor Wire with a little Iron to protect your base from being over run by Zombies.

Tobacco!

You can trade some of your ammunition for a single Tobacco Plant Seed then the rest is up to you.

Once you have your seeds you can start building your Tobacco Farm.

Tobacco Plants will grow over time but you can speed up the process with Bone Meal.

When your Tobacco Plants are fully grown, break them to harvest the Tobacco Leaves and Seeds.

To get your Tobacco ready for trading you need to pack it correctly, to do this you need a Preperation Table.

Before packing the Tabacco Leaves in bags they need to be bundled together

When you have enough Bundles of Tobacco you can bag them up ready to trading.
